Is Harvard Med School Pass-Fail?

In the required preclerkship and principal clinical years at HMS, students are graded on a pass/fail basis, a structural strategy that allows them to focus on becoming leaders in improving patient care rather than focusing on class rank.

Is medical school pass or fail?

Data indicates that pass-fail grading in preclinical training—usually the first two years of medical school—is becoming more common. During the 2017–2018 academic year, 108 schools used pass-fail grading in preclerkship courses, according to the Association of American Medical Colleges (AAMC).

Is Harvard getting rid of grades?

Instead of the usual grades of As to Fs, Harvard has decided to award ‘Emergency Satisfactory’ or ‘Emergency Unsatisfactory’ for postgraduate students for the spring semester, said Claudine Gay, Edgerley Family Dean of the Faculty of Arts and Sciences at Harvard. Undergraduates will be given a universal pass or fail.

Is it hard to get into Harvard Medical School?

With an acceptance rate of only 3.3%, Harvard denies over 6,000 applicants each year. Since a high GPA and MCAT score won’t be enough to separate you from the pile, you might wonder exactly how to get into Harvard Medical School. In 2019, HMS accepted only 227 out of over 6,800 candidates.

What is a passing grade at Harvard?

Grades of D+ through D– are passing but unsatisfactory grades. Grades of E, ABS (Absent), NCR (No Credit), FL (Fail), UNS (Unsatisfactory), and EXLD (Excluded) are failing grades. The grade of INCOMPLETE (INC) cannot under any circumstances be given to undergraduates.

What happens if you fail a class at Harvard?

harvard. Students are normally allowed to repeat failed courses for both grade and credit. Note, however, that the failing grade received when the course was taken the first time remains a permanent part of the College record, and both remain factored into the grade point average.
